On Quark Substructures in an Inspired Unified Model

Abstract

Motivated by the growing attention devoted to the Quantum Chromodynamics sector of the Standard Model, and the recent observations of non-standard hadronic states, a possible substructure of quarks qf Cij|kikj in terms of four colorless bound particles % ki(=0,…,3) "hyperparticles" is investigated in a SO(10)-inspired unified model. This aims to define a subtle structure of matter as well as an explanation of some particularities of quarks. Precisley, these hyperquarks ki are bound by a SU(3)h "hyperstrong force" under which they are assumed to be charged. Exploiting certain known data, the masses and the charges of such fundamental particles are discussed along with the emerged four extra quarks qf δii|kiki and three hyperweak bosons Wh.
